The Volkswagen Transporter (T6) Kombi 2.0 TSI (150 Hp) L2H1, produced between 2015 and 2018, represents a significant iteration in Volkswagen’s long-running Transporter lineage. Part of the sixth generation (T6) of the iconic van, the Kombi variant caters to a diverse range of needs, blending commercial practicality with passenger comfort. Primarily sold in Europe and other international markets, the T6 Transporter aimed to improve upon its predecessor (T5) with enhanced fuel efficiency, updated technology, and a more refined driving experience. The “L2H1” designation refers to the vehicle’s body length (L2 – long wheelbase) and roof height (H1 – standard roof), defining a specific configuration within the broader T6 range. This model served as a versatile option for families, tradespeople, and those requiring a spacious and adaptable vehicle.

Engine & Performance
The heart of the Transporter (T6) Kombi 2.0 TSI (150 Hp) L2H1 is the EA888 2.0-liter turbocharged four-cylinder gasoline engine, specifically the CJKB engine code. This engine delivers 150 horsepower at 3750-6000 rpm and 280 Nm (206.52 lb.-ft.) of torque between 1500-3750 rpm. The direct injection system and turbocharger contribute to a responsive driving experience and relatively good fuel economy for a vehicle of its size. Power is sent to the front wheels via a six-speed manual transmission. Ac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h (0-62 mph) takes 11.5 seconds, while 0-60 mph is achieved in approximately 10.9 seconds. The vehicle boasts a maximum speed of 182 km/h (113.09 mph). The engine’s power-to-weight ratio is 12.3 kg/Hp, and the torque-to-weight ratio is 6.6 kg/Nm, indicating a reasonable balance between power and mass. The inclusion of a Start & Stop system further enhances fuel efficiency in urban driving conditions.
Design & Features
The T6 Transporter Kombi L2H1 features a traditional van silhouette, optimized for both practicality and aerodynamics. The L2 wheelbase provides a generous cargo area, while the H1 roof height maintains a manageable overall height. The Kombi variant distinguishes itself with comfortable seating for up to nine passengers, configurable to prioritize either passenger space or cargo capacity. Interior features include a functional dashboard layout, ergonomic seating, and ample storage compartments. Safety features, crucial in modern vehicles, include ABS (Anti-lock Braking System) and a robust chassis designed for stability and handling. The vehicle’s dimensions are as follows: length 5304 mm (208.82 in), width 1904 mm (74.96 in), height 1990 mm (78.35 in), and wheelbase 3400 mm (133.86 in). Ground clearance is a respectable 202 mm (7.95 in), providing good capability on varied road surfaces. The turning circle is 13.2 meters (43.31 ft).
